Featured events

« August 2019 »
MonTueWedThuFriSatSun
1234
567891011
12131415161718
19202122232425
262728293031

Laboratorio de Sistemas Electrónicos Digitales (LSED)

Créditos Totales: 
3.0
Créditos Teóricos: 
0.0
Créditos Prácticos: 
3.0
Créditos de Laboratorio: 
3.0
Delivery dates: 
Segundo semestre
Type of subject: 
Troncal/obligatoria
Website of the subject: 
http://lsed.die.upm.es/
Instructional Objectives: 

A) Objetivos competenciales. A.1) Aplicación y consolidación de competencias sobre sistemas basados en microprocesadores. - Diseñar, implementar y probar programas en C o ensamblador: sencillos algoritmos, pequeños drivers de dispositivos, máquinas de estados, etc. que sigan en su conjunto el diseño de alto nivel propuesto en el enunciado. - Programar un sistema de tiempo real (con al menos una interrupción). A.2) Adquisición y aplicación de habilidades sobre programación de sistemas autónomos o empotrados (hardware y software). - Manejar una herramienta integrada de desarrollo (EDColdFire, etc.). - Depurar un programa en C o en ensamblador. A.3) Aprendizaje de aspectos prácticos de diseño realista de alto nivel. - Aplicar una metodología de trabajo basada en la descomposición arquitectural propuesta: implementación modular, prueba modular e integración y prueba incremental. A.4) Aplicación y consolidación de competencias en electrónica analógica y digital. - Aplicación y consolidación de competencias sobre instrumentación electrónica: utilizar el osciloscopio digital / analógico para llevar a cabo medidas (niveles de señal, niveles de ruido, frecuencias de señal, duración de un transitorio, etc.), utilizar la fuente de tensión para alimentar el prototipo y para generar niveles variables de voltaje, utilizar el generador de funciones para caracterizar o probar filtros analógicos, etc. - Implementar y probar prototipos hardware en placa de inserción, en wire-wrapping o en placa de circuito impreso (PCB). A.5) Aprendizaje de aspectos prácticos de índole técnico-profesional. - Manejar un sistema operativo profesional en el nivel de usuario. - Llevar a cabo una adecuada política de copias de seguridad. - Seguir unas normas de codificación de carácter profesional: estructura de un programa, normalización de nombres, política de variables y subrutinas, etc. - Manejar e interpretar manuales profesionales, aprendizaje de algún elemento electrónico nuevo: sensor de temperatura, ADC, etc.). - Planificar el tiempo para lograr acabar la memoria a tiempo. - Planificar el tiempo para lograr acabar el proyecto a tiempo. - Escribir (memoria final) y exponer oralmente un trabajo técnico desarrollado. - Introducir mejoras en el diseño de un sistema electrónico basado en un microprocesador. - Implementar un sistema multi-disciplinar que aplique la electrónica en el campo de las telecomunicaciones (el problema práctico propuesto hace referencia a materias externas a los circuitos electrónicos digitales, analógicos y sistemas electrónicos digitales, pero muy relacionadas: control de motores, tratamiento de señal, comunicaciones digitales, etc.). B) Objetivos cognitivos generales. B.1) Aplicación y consolidación de conocimientos de electrónica analógica y digital previamente adquiridos (en CEAN, CEDG, etc.). - Diseñar sistemas basados en circuitos MSI analógicos o digitales, con cálculos y justificaciones sobre: diseño de filtros con amplificadores operacionales, polarización de diodos y visualizadores, conexión de teclados, etc. B.2) Aplicación y consolidación de los conocimientos sobre sistemas basados en microprocesadores o microcontroladores (adquiridos en SEDG). - Analizar programas y sistemas basados en un microprocesador o un microcontrolador concreto, en lenguaje C o en ensamblador.

Program: 

Programa Práctica de diseño, implantación y prueba de un sistema electrónico digital basado en Microprocesadores/microcontroladores (3 crd.): -Conocimiento de los equipos de desarrollo: 0,3 crd. -Análisis y diseño del prototipo propuesto (HW y SW): 0,9 crd. -Construcción y prueba del HW.: 0,3 crd. -Codificación y prueba del SW: 1,2 crd. -Prueba de integración final y evaluación del análisis, diseño, implantación y pruebas realizados: 0,3 crd.

Review: 

La evaluación de la asignatura se basará en dos aspectos: 1) Memoria escrita: se entregará una memoria escrita sobre la práctica realizada (en formato electrónico y en papel). Se valorarán los aspectos siguientes: -Una explicación de cada uno de los bloques que componen el sistema, justificando la solución adoptada y los problemas encontrados durante la implementación. -Presentación de diagramas de bloques en los que puedan apreciarse fácilmente las conexiones del sistema y se destaquen las más importantes (aunque no se respete en ellos la disposición real de patillaje del hardware utilizado). -Explicación de las mejoras realizadas sobre la práctica básica. Listados de software realizado debidamente comentados y estructurados 2) Pruebas orales en las que el alumno mostrará los resultados alcanzados en la práctica (durante el curso de la asignatura y al finalizar la misma) y se le harán preguntas para que demuestre que ha comprendido su funcionamiento. La puntuación conseguida reflejará: -La complejidad de la práctica realizada (especialmente en sus aspectos hardware). -El grado de innovación de los resultados obtenidos. -La calidad de la memoria y el trabajo presentados (incluyendo la estructuración y comentarios del código). -Los conocimientos de la práctica demostrados en las pruebas de evaluación. Aunque pueda parecer obvio, los dos alumnos de la pareja deben dominar todos los aspectos de las prácticas hechas.

Faculty
Coordinator: 
Professor: 
Más Información
Subject code: 
LSED -090000309
Course Number which belongs within the qualification: 
3
Previous Knowledge: 

SEDG, LCEL, FPRG y LPRG.

Center impartation: 
ETSIT
Academic year of teaching: 
2012-2013
Bibliography: 

San-Segundo, R., Montero, JM., et al (2006) "Desarrollo de Sistemas Digitales con el Microcontrolador MCF5272". Marcombo. San-Segundo, R., Montero, JM., et al (2005) "Entorno de desarrollo EDColdFire v3.0". Dpto. Ingeniería Electrónica. ETSIT-UPM. Carreras, C., Córdoba, R., Ledesma, MJ., Montero, JM,. San-Segundo, R., (2007) "Diseño de sistemas digitales con el microcontrolador ColdFire 5272". Dpto. Ingeniería Electrónica. ETSIT-UPM. Ferreiros, J. et al (2002) "Aspectos prácticos de diseño y medida en laboratorios de electrónica". Dpto. Ingeniería Electrónica. ETSIT-UPM. 2002. Manuales de Motorola, http://www.freescale.com: MCF5272 ColdFire Integrated Microprocessor User�s Manual. ColdFire Family Programmer�s Reference Manual. Version 2/2M ColdFire Core Processor User�s Manual. Clements, A. (1992) "Microprocessor Systems Design" Segunda edición. Ed. MPWS-Kent Pub. Co. Kernighan,Brian W. ; Ritchie, Dennis M. "The C Programming Language", Second Edition. Ed. Prentice Hall, Inc. Schildt, H. "C: Manual de referencia" Ed. McGraw Hill

Tribunal
Secretary: 
Results
Short description: the work: 
<p><a href="http://lsed.die.upm.es/">http://lsed.die.upm.es/</a></p>